The nightly reconciler compares warehouse counts in Ledgerbarn against the storefront cache and emits correction events. Two gotchas: first, it must run after the 02:00 import finishes, or it will flag thousands of false mismatches; there is a lock file check but it has raced before. Second, corrections above the threshold are queued for manual review rather than auto-applied — resist the urge to raise that threshold. Dead-letter handling is manual; check the queue weekly. The job starts by loading these configuration values.

service settings:
[silwyn]
host = silwyn.crelvogrid.internal
user = silwyn_svc
database = silwyn_prod

Release checklist — Bouncewright processor, support sign-off. Before we flip the flag, make sure the new suppression rules don't eat legit retries — spot-check twenty soft bounces in the Sandpiper staging inbox and confirm they re-queue. Also verify the customer-facing bounce reasons read sanely; last release they were full of raw SMTP codes and tickets spiked. Once you've checked both, mark this item done and note the build you tested, which appears below.

session token of yajof-bagef = htk4_937d

## Deploying the Gatewick Proctor Queue

Deploys are pretty painless: push to main, wait for the pipeline, then watch the queue drain dashboard for five minutes. If candidates pile up mid-exam, roll back first and ask questions later — the queue replays safely. Everything the workers care about lives in one config block, shown here for reference.

settings of bafof-yagef:
JOROX_PIN=8740
JOROX_TENANT=pelox
JOROX_METRICS_HOST=metrics.jorox.qorvelworks.internal
JOROX_SEAL=seal_c78f63c1
JOROX_STANDBY_TEAM=norax

**Vendor note — log sampling for Pellwright ingest**

Our vendor Graybeam confirmed the chatty telemetry from the Pellwright service is inflating our ingest bill by roughly 30%. They recommend head-based sampling at 10% for INFO lines, keeping errors unsampled. To approve the sampling contract amendment, write to their account desk at the address below.

escalation mailbox, bafog-fafog: ulador@paliqlabs.internal